About 1-[(3-methyl-[1,2]oxazolo[5,4-b]pyridin-5-yl)sulfonyl]-N-phenylpiperidin-3-amine
1-[(3-methyl-[1,2]oxazolo[5,4-b]pyridin-5-yl)sulfonyl]-N-phenylpiperidin-3-amine (PubChem CID 127489277) has the molecular formula C18H20N4O3S
and a molecular weight of 372.45 g/mol. Its IUPAC name is 1-[(3-methyl-[1,2]oxazolo[5,4-b]pyridin-5-yl)sulfonyl]-N-phenylpiperidin-3-amine.

What is the SMILES notation for 1-[(3-methyl-[1,2]oxazolo[5,4-b]pyridin-5-yl)sulfonyl]-N-phenylpiperidin-3-amine?
The canonical SMILES for 1-[(3-methyl-[1,2]oxazolo[5,4-b]pyridin-5-yl)sulfonyl]-N-phenylpiperidin-3-amine is Cc1noc2ncc(S(=O)(=O)N3CCCC(Nc4ccccc4)C3)cc12.
What is the InChIKey of 1-[(3-methyl-[1,2]oxazolo[5,4-b]pyridin-5-yl)sulfonyl]-N-phenylpiperidin-3-amine?
The InChIKey is GJBFVOBISXXGDJ-UHFFFAOYSA-N. The full InChI is InChI=1S/C18H20N4O3S/c1-13-17-10-16(11-19-18(17)25-21-13)26(23,24)22-9-5-8-15(12-22)20-14-6-3-2-4-7-14/h2-4,6-7,10-11,15,20H,5,8-9,12H2,1H3.
What are the key properties of 1-[(3-methyl-[1,2]oxazolo[5,4-b]pyridin-5-yl)sulfonyl]-N-phenylpiperidin-3-amine?
1-[(3-methyl-[1,2]oxazolo[5,4-b]pyridin-5-yl)sulfonyl]-N-phenylpiperidin-3-amine has a molecular weight of 372.45 g/mol, XLogP of 2.80, 4 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
